Believe it or not, Walmart is a good place to get installation kits. They sell Scoshe, it's pretty good stuff. That's about the only stereo stuff I'll recommend from walmart.

You can also make your own installation kit. I have used 1/4" plexiglass for the face, and MDF for supports for the new head unit. The plexi can be painted, and if you take your time, can be painted with a nice grained texture.
